Nose Vents, Effective Snoring Solution, Nasal Dilators, Anti Snoring Devices, Snore Stopper
745921466207
sku: 17592306566812
$2.51
Shipping from: United States
Description
Faster shipping. Better service
Price history chart & currency exchange rate